After 30+ years in the dating world, here’s something that still makes me shake my head (and sometimes laugh out loud):
the smarter someone is in real life, the weirder they can be online.
(ok, what I really wanted to say was: Is there an inverse correlation between how smart you are in every day stuff and how dumb you are online?)

You run global companies. You’re performing robotic surgeries. You’re the volunteer queen. A master gardener. You’re literally a Mensa member — yet your first message is, “Hey there 😊.”
What happens between the boardroom and Bumble? It’s like the IQ drops 50 points when Wi-Fi connects.
Overthink their profile like it’s a Supreme Court brief.
You’re not filing an appeal — it’s Bumble, not the Harvard Law Review.
Use their SAT score as a personality trait.
Congrats on the 1560, Einstein, but can you plan a great date?
Lead with “Sapiosexual.”
Translation: “I’m about to lecture you on AI ethics.”
Forget punctuation but remember Nietzsche quotes.
Because commas are for commoners, apparently.
Upload one blurry conference photo from 2012.
Caption: “At a symposium.” No one knows what that means. Or cares.
Message like they’re teaching a seminar.
“Your question reminds me of Kant’s categorical imperative.” 🥴
Miss obvious flirting cues.
You: “Cute dog!”
Them: “He’s a Hungarian Vizsla, originally bred in the 14th century.”
Flirtation: deceased.
Argue in the first five messages.
Debate team instincts die hard. You’re not winning — you’re repelling.
Correct typos mid-flirt.
“Your dinner looks great.” → “You’re.” Way to kill the vibe, Grammarly.
List every Ivy League school in 200 characters.
We get it. You collect diplomas. Try collecting experiences next.
💡 The Takeaway
Dating isn’t a Rubik cube — it’s chemistry, emotion, and timing.
Brains are sexy, but connection is what lasts.
So if you’re brilliant and baffled by online dating, maybe close the spreadsheets and open up. Authenticity beats algorithms every time. Thrown in with a push from a pro.
